Attitudes toward criminal Jjstice policies: further evidence against the “gender gap”
For decades, scholars have examined the role of gender in shaping attitudes toward criminal justice policy. Specifically, research has attempted to explore whether a “gender gap” in public attitudes exists. Although women tend to differ from men regarding patterns of offending and victimization expe...
